@font-face{font-family:"opensans-regular";src:url("/templates/default/fonts/opensans-regular.eot");src:url("/templates/default/fonts/opensans-regular.eot?#iefix") format("eot"), url("/templates/default/fonts/opensans-regular.woff") format("woff"), url("/templates/default/fonts/opensans-regular.woff2") format("woff2"), url("/templates/default/fonts/opensans-regular.ttf") format("truetype"), url("/templates/default/fonts/opensans-regular.svg") format("svg");font-weight:normal;font-style:normal;font-display:swap}@font-face{font-family:"opensans-light";src:url("/templates/default/fonts/opensans-light.eot");src:url("/templates/default/fonts/opensans-light.eot?#iefix") format("eot"), url("/templates/default/fonts/opensans-light.woff") format("woff"), url("/templates/default/fonts/opensans-light.woff2") format("woff2"), url("/templates/default/fonts/opensans-light.ttf") format("truetype"), url("/templates/default/fonts/opensans-light.svg") format("svg");font-weight:normal;font-style:normal;font-display:swap}:root{--progress-percent: 0%}*{box-sizing:border-box}#background-container{position:fixed;z-index:2;top:0px;right:0px;bottom:0px;left:0px;background-color:#232323}#background-container .imgC{position:absolute;z-index:2;top:0px;right:0px;bottom:0px;left:0px;opacity:0;transition:opacity 3.5s;background-size:cover;background-repeat:no-repeat;background-position:center}#background-container .imgC.visible{opacity:1}#toaster-container{position:fixed;z-index:1000000;bottom:2rem;left:50%;transform:translateX(-50%);width:calc(100vw - 2rem);display:flex;flex-wrap:wrap;justify-content:center}#toaster-container .toaster{width:100%;margin:5px;max-height:0px;overflow:hidden;transition:all 0.3s;display:flex;justify-content:center;border-radius:8px}#toaster-container .toaster .wrapper{line-height:22px;padding:7px 11px 7px 40px;border-radius:10px;background-size:22px 22px;background-position:0.5rem 0.5rem;background-repeat:no-repeat;box-shadow:rgba(0, 0, 0, 0.7) 0 25px 50px -15px, rgba(0, 0, 0, 0.7) 0px 0px 5px}#toaster-container .toaster.show{max-height:54px}#toaster-container .toaster.success .wrapper{background-image:url("/templates/default/images/success.svg");background-color:#339933;border:1px solid #FFF;color:#FFF}#toaster-container .toaster.error .wrapper{background-image:url("/templates/default/images/error.svg");background-color:#990000;border:1px solid #FFF;color:#FFF}#dialog{position:relative;z-index:100;color:#444;background:#FFF;border:1px solid #EEE;box-shadow:rgba(0, 0, 0, 0.7) 0 25px 50px -15px, rgba(0, 0, 0, 0.7) 0px 0px 5px;width:100%;min-height:100vh;z-index:1;opacity:0;transition:opacity 0.2s}@media only screen and (min-width:576px){#dialog{position:fixed;border-radius:1rem;max-width:476px;min-height:auto}}#dialog #dialog-logo{padding-top:0.5rem;padding-bottom:0rem}#dialog #dialog-logo svg{width:180px;display:block;margin:0 auto}#dialog .links-under-dialog{display:flex;flex-wrap:wrap;justify-content:center}#dialog .links-under-dialog a{padding:0.5rem 1rem;display:block;color:#000;font-weight:bold;text-decoration:none;font-size:0.8rem;white-space:nowrap;cursor:pointer}@media only screen and (min-width:576px){#dialog .links-under-dialog a{color:#FFF;font-weight:normal;text-shadow:2px 2px 2px black}}@media only screen and (min-width:576px){#dialog .links-under-dialog{transform:translateY(100%);position:absolute;bottom:0px;left:0px;right:0px}}#dialog #dialog-inner{overflow:auto;position:relative;height:calc(100vh - 100px);padding:0.5rem 1rem 1rem 1rem}@media only screen and (min-width:576px){#dialog #dialog-inner{height:auto;max-height:calc(80vh - 100px);border-bottom-right-radius:1rem}}body.init-complete #dialog{z-index:100;opacity:1}.upload-in-progress #upload-container{display:none}#upload-container .request-headline{text-align:center;color:#04BDBA;font-size:1.5rem;padding-bottom:1rem}#upload-container .request-title{text-align:center;font-size:1.1rem;padding-bottom:1rem;font-weight:bold}#upload-container .columns{display:flex;flex-wrap:wrap}#upload-container .columns .files{width:100%}#upload-container .columns .files .queue-filelist{width:100%;background:#F5F5F7;border-radius:5px}#upload-container .columns .files .queue-filelist #upload-filelist{display:none;margin:0px;padding:0.3rem 0.5rem}#upload-container .columns .files .queue-filelist #upload-filelist .file-item{position:relative;width:100%;display:flex;flex-wrap:wrap;align-items:center;list-style-type:none;padding:6px 24px 6px 30px;background-image:url("/templates/default/images/file-earmark.svg");background-size:22px;background-position:left 3px;background-repeat:no-repeat}#upload-container .columns .files .queue-filelist #upload-filelist .file-item.file-type-image{background-image:url("/templates/default/images/file-type-image.svg")}#upload-container .columns .files .queue-filelist #upload-filelist .file-item.file-type-pdf{background-image:url("/templates/default/images/file-type-pdf.svg")}#upload-container .columns .files .queue-filelist #upload-filelist .file-item.file-type-video{background-image:url("/templates/default/images/file-type-video.svg")}#upload-container .columns .files .queue-filelist #upload-filelist .file-item.file-type-zip{background-image:url("/templates/default/images/file-type-zip.svg")}#upload-container .columns .files .queue-filelist #upload-filelist .file-item .file-name{order:1;width:100%;word-break:break-all;font-family:"opensans-regular";font-size:0.9rem;line-height:1.2em}#upload-container .columns .files .queue-filelist #upload-filelist .file-item .file-size{order:2;width:100%;font-size:0.7rem}#upload-container .columns .files .queue-filelist #upload-filelist .file-item .file-delete{position:absolute;display:none;top:5px;right:0px;width:16px;height:16px;background:url("/templates/default/images/x-lg.svg");background-size:contain;background-position:center;background-repeat:no-repeat;cursor:pointer}#upload-container .columns .files .queue-filelist #upload-filelist .file-item:hover .file-delete{display:block}#upload-container .columns .files .files-header .files-in-queue{font-size:1.1rem;font-family:"opensans-regular"}#upload-container .columns .files .files-header .size-remaining-row{font-size:0.7rem;color:#444}#upload-container .columns .files #browse-button{width:100%;display:flex;flex-wrap:wrap;color:#333;text-decoration:none;margin-top:10px;font-size:0.9rem;background:#F5F5F7;height:220px;align-items:center;justify-content:center;border-radius:10px}#upload-container .columns .files #browse-button .inner{width:100%;display:flex;flex-wrap:wrap;justify-content:center}#upload-container .columns .files #browse-button .inner .icon{width:44px;height:44px;border-radius:10px;background:#04BDBA;padding:10px;margin-bottom:10px}#upload-container .columns .files #browse-button .inner .icon svg{display:block;fill:#FFF}#upload-container .columns .files #browse-button .inner .label{width:100%;height:44px;text-align:center}#upload-container .columns .files #browse-button .inner .label .files{display:none}#upload-container .columns .files #browse-button .inner .label .title{width:100%;font-weight:bold}#upload-container .columns .files #browse-button .inner .label .subtitle{width:100%;font-size:0.8em;color:#666}#upload-container .columns #share-formdata{width:100%;display:none;flex-direction:column}#upload-container .columns #share-formdata .header{height:50px;padding-bottom:6px;display:none}#upload-container .columns #share-formdata .header a{cursor:pointer;width:0px;flex:1;display:flex;align-items:center;color:#333;background:#F5F5F7;text-decoration:none}#upload-container .columns #share-formdata .header a .icon{width:44px;height:44px;border-radius:22px;padding:10px}#upload-container .columns #share-formdata .header a .icon svg{display:block;fill:#888}#upload-container .columns #share-formdata .header a .label{font-weight:bold}#upload-container .columns #share-formdata .header a:first-child{border-top-left-radius:10px;border-bottom-left-radius:10px}#upload-container .columns #share-formdata .header a:last-child{border-top-right-radius:10px;border-bottom-right-radius:10px}#upload-container .columns #share-formdata .header a.active{color:#FFF;background:#04BDBA}#upload-container .columns #share-formdata .header a.active .icon svg{fill:#FFF}#uploader-drop-zone{position:fixed;z-index:10000;top:0px;right:0px;bottom:0px;left:0px;background:rgba(0, 0, 0, 0.4);display:none;justify-content:center;align-items:center}#uploader-drop-zone.active{display:flex}#uploader-drop-zone .center .icon{width:300px}#uploader-drop-zone .center .icon svg{display:block;fill:#FFF;filter:drop-shadow(3px 5px 2px rgba(0, 0, 0, 0.4))}#upload-progress{z-index:1000;position:relative;width:100%;height:0px;padding-bottom:100%;display:none}.upload-in-progress #upload-progress{display:block}#upload-progress .inner{position:absolute;top:0px;right:0px;bottom:0px;left:0px;display:flex;justify-content:center;align-items:center;background:#FFF}#upload-progress .inner .progress-circle-all{transform:rotate(-90deg)}#upload-progress .inner .progress-circle-all .circle{stroke:#F5F5F7}#upload-progress .inner .progress-circle-all .progress{stroke:#04BDBA}#upload-progress .inner .infos{position:absolute;text-align:center}#upload-progress .inner .infos .percent-all-infos{font-size:3rem;line-height:1.1em;color:#04BDBA}#upload-progress .inner .infos .file-counter{font-size:1rem;line-height:1.8em}#upload-progress .inner .infos .speed{font-size:0.7rem;line-height:2em}#share-link-container .title{text-align:center;color:#04BDBA;font-size:2rem}#share-link-container .top-text{text-align:center;padding:10px 0px 10px 0px}#share-link-container .share-link-row{overflow:hidden;background:#F5F5F7;border-radius:10px;display:flex}#share-link-container .share-link-row input{flex:1;border:none;background:transparent;outline:none;font-size:1rem;padding:0.5rem}#share-link-container .share-link-row .copy-link-button{width:44px;height:44px;padding:0.5rem;background:#04BDBA;cursor:pointer}#share-link-container .share-link-row .copy-link-button svg{display:block;fill:#FFF}#share-link-container .share-expire-row{text-align:center;padding:10px 0px 10px 0px;font-size:0.8rem;color:#999}#request-link-container .title{text-align:center;color:#04BDBA;font-size:2rem}#request-link-container .top-text{text-align:center;padding:10px 0px 10px 0px}#request-link-container .request-link-row{overflow:hidden;background:#F5F5F7;border-radius:10px;display:flex}#request-link-container .request-link-row input{flex:1;border:none;background:transparent;outline:none;font-size:1rem;padding:0.5rem}#request-link-container .request-link-row .copy-link-button{width:44px;height:44px;padding:0.5rem;background:#04BDBA;cursor:pointer}#request-link-container .request-link-row .copy-link-button svg{display:block;fill:#FFF}#request-link-container .request-expire-row{text-align:center;padding:10px 0px 10px 0px;font-size:0.8rem;color:#999}.share-link-invalid{text-align:center}.share-link-invalid .title{color:#04BDBA;font-size:2rem}.share-link-invalid .text{padding-top:0.5rem}.queue-filelist{width:100%;background:#F5F5F7;border-radius:5px;margin-top:0.5rem}.queue-filelist #download-filelist{display:block;margin:0px;padding:0.3rem 0.5rem}.queue-filelist #download-filelist .file-item{position:relative;width:100%;display:flex;flex-wrap:wrap;align-items:center;list-style-type:none;padding:6px 24px 6px 30px;background:url("/templates/default/images/file-earmark.svg");background-size:22px;background-position:left 3px;background-repeat:no-repeat;text-decoration:none;color:#666}.queue-filelist #download-filelist .file-item .file-name{order:1;width:100%;word-break:break-all;font-family:"opensans-regular";font-size:0.9rem;line-height:1.2em}.queue-filelist #download-filelist .file-item .file-size{order:2;width:100%;font-size:0.7rem}.queue-filelist #download-filelist .file-item .file-download{position:absolute;display:none;top:6px;right:0px;width:16px;height:16px;background:url("/templates/default/images/box-arrow-down.svg");background-size:contain;background-position:center;background-repeat:no-repeat;cursor:pointer}.queue-filelist #download-filelist .file-item:hover .file-download{display:block}.download-expire-row{text-align:center;padding:10px 0px 0px 0px;font-size:0.8rem;color:#888}.queue-download-button{padding-top:10px}.scrollbar-track.scrollbar-track-y{width:3px}.scrollbar-track.scrollbar-track-y .scrollbar-thumb-y{width:3px}body{font-family:"opensans-light";background:#FFF;margin:0px;padding:0px}body.files-selected #upload-container .columns .files .queue-filelist #upload-filelist{display:block}body.files-selected #upload-container .columns .files .files-header{padding-top:10px}body.files-selected #upload-container .columns #browse-button{height:auto;justify-content:flex-start}body.files-selected #upload-container .columns #browse-button .inner{justify-content:flex-start}body.files-selected #upload-container .columns #browse-button .inner .icon{margin-bottom:0px}body.files-selected #upload-container .columns #browse-button .inner .label{padding-left:10px;width:0px;flex:1;text-align:left;display:flex;flex-direction:column;flex-wrap:wrap;align-items:center;justify-content:center}body.files-selected #upload-container .columns #browse-button .inner .label .no-files{display:none}body.files-selected #upload-container .columns #browse-button .inner .label .files{display:contents}body.files-selected #upload-container .columns #share-formdata{display:flex}.noselect{-webkit-touch-callout:none;-webkit-user-select:none;-khtml-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none}#page-logo{position:fixed;z-index:10;left:50%;top:1rem;width:200px;margin-left:-100px}#page-logo svg{fill:#FFF}iframe{display:none}input,button,select,textarea{width:100%;background:#FFF;font-family:"opensans-regular";padding:0.5rem;outline:none;border:none;line-height:44px;height:44px;font-size:1rem}button[type=submit],.main-button{display:flex;align-items:center;justify-content:center;color:#FFF;background-color:#04BDBA;text-decoration:none;border-radius:10px;font-size:1.1rem;font-weight:bold;height:44px;cursor:pointer}select{border:1px solid #EEE;border-radius:10px}select *{font-family:"opensans-regular", Arial, Helvetica, sans-serif}textarea,input[type="text"]{resize:none;border:1px solid #EEE;border-radius:10px;padding:0.5rem;line-height:22px;height:calc(22px + 2px + 1rem)}::-webkit-input-placeholder{color:#DDD}:-ms-input-placeholder{color:#DDD}::placeholder{color:#DDD}form .headline{text-align:center;color:#04BDBA;font-size:2rem;line-height:1.1em;padding-bottom:0.5rem}form hr{width:100%;display:block;border:none;padding:0px;margin:15px 0px 10px 0px;height:1px;background:#CCC}form .row{display:flex;flex-wrap:wrap;align-items:center;font-size:0.95rem;padding:0.25rem 0}form .row .label{width:50%;font-weight:bold;font-size:0.9rem;line-height:44px;font-size:0.8rem}form .row .label.col1{width:100%;line-height:22px}form .row .input{width:50%}form .row .input.col1{width:100%}form .row.nopad-bottom{padding-bottom:none}form .row.spacer{flex:1}form .row.submit{display:block;padding:0.5rem 0 0 0}form .section-link{display:flex;justify-content:flex-start;align-items:center;text-decoration:none;color:#048886;cursor:pointer;margin:0.5rem 0}form .section-link .label{width:auto;white-space:nowrap;font-size:0.9rem;line-height:1.2em}form .section-link .arrow{margin-left:8px;width:16px}form .section-link .arrow svg{display:block;fill:#048886}form .section-link.active .arrow{transform:rotate(90deg)}form .toggle-section{display:none}form .toggle-section.active{display:block}.warning-headline{text-align:center;color:#FF0000;font-size:1.5rem;padding-bottom:1rem}.files-in-queue .one{display:none}.files-in-queue .more{display:none}.files-in-queue.zero .more,.files-in-queue.more .more{display:inline-block}.files-in-queue.one .one{display:inline-block}/*# sourceMappingURL=./theme.all.map */